# Aptosネットワークの8つの革新推進力Aptosは、遅延が非常に低く、スループットが非常に高いブロックチェーンプラットフォームとして、開発者がweb3アプリケーションを構築するための大きな利便性を提供します。この記事では、Aptosネットワークの繁栄を促進する8つのコアイノベーションについて紹介します。! [Aptosを新しいパブリックチェーンのリーダーにするための8つのイノベーション](https://img-cdn.gateio.im/social/moments-52ea3791dc1988fed2be50f7cd9744ae)## 1. Move言語はアプリケーション開発を最適化しますAptosはMoveプログラミング言語を統合しており、開発者にとってより良い開発環境と効率を提供しています。Moveは表現力が高く、使いやすい言語であり、安全な資産管理のために設計されています。Aptosは、言語とフレームワークのレベルで多くの機能を追加することによって、Moveエコシステムを大幅に改善しました。これには、完全なセキュリティアーキテクチャ、設定可能なガス計測、コードのアップグレード可能性などが含まれます。Moveバリデーターはスマートコントラクトに追加のセキュリティ保証を提供し、Aptos上で積極的に拡張されています。多くのMove言語の初期研究者や開発者は、Aptosエコシステムで活躍し続け、Move言語とコミュニティを強化しています。4年間のテストと検証を経て、Moveは生産環境で使用できる成熟した開発言語となりました。## 2. Block-STMはより多くのプログラミングの自由度を提供しますBlock-STMは、新しいタイプのスマートコントラクト並行実行エンジンであり、Aptosのトランザクションメモリと楽観的並行制御原則に基づいて構築されています。この新しいトランザクション並行化手法は、開発体験に影響を与えることなく、トランザクション処理速度を向上させることができます。他の取引のアトミシティを破壊する必要がある並行実行エンジンとは異なり、Block-STMは開発者が制約なくコーディングできるようにし、実際のアプリケーションで高いスループットと低いレイテンシを実現します。開発者は、より豊富なアトミシティ操作をサポートする高度に並行化されたアプリケーションを簡単に構築でき、ユーザーエクスペリエンスを向上させます。## 3. オンチェーンガバナンスが分散化を促進するAptosは、ネットワークと仮想マシンの設定をシームレスに変更できるオンチェーンガバナンスメカニズムを備えており、真の分散型で無許可のlayer1をサポートしています。Aptosコミュニティは、epochの持続時間の変更、バリデーターの権益要件、コアコードのアップグレードなど、ブロックチェーンの動作に影響を与える提案を作成し、投票することができました。## 4. AptosBFTv4によるコンセンサス効率の向上AptosBFTv4は、厳格な正当性証明を持つ最初の商用ブロックチェーンBFTプロトコルです。これはHotstuffを基に改良され、提出の遅延を3ステップから2ステップに減少させ、通信コストを犠牲にすることなく33%の遅延を削減しました。AptosBFTv4の実装は、安全性とアップグレード可能性を考慮し、不変量を明確に分離して隔離と監査を容易にしています。同一のソフトウェアは4回のアップグレードを経て実際のネットワークでテストされ、その開発プロセスの周到さと堅牢性が証明されました。## 5. ユーザーの信頼を高めるためのセキュリティ対策Aptosアカウントは、キーのローテーション、暗号化の機敏性、ハイブリッドホスティングモデルなど、柔軟なキー管理をサポートしています。アカウントとキーのデカップリングにより、Aptosは新しいデジタル署名アルゴリズムをシームレスに追加できるようになります。ウォレットは取引の事前実行機能を使用でき、ユーザーが署名する前に取引結果を説明し、フィッシングなどのセキュリティリスクを軽減します。Aptosは、シリアル番号、期限、チェーンIDの三重保護を通じて、署名の無限の有効性を防ぎます。Aptosのコンセンサスプロトコルと認証されたストレージは、軽量クライアントへのシームレスなサポートを実現し、より安全で信頼性の高いユーザー体験を提供します。誰でもフルノードに接続して、認証されたデータに直接アクセスできます。## 6. 未来に向けたモジュール式アーキテクチャAptosはモジュール化された柔軟な設計理念を採用しており、頻繁なアップグレードをサポートし、最新の技術革新を迅速に取り入れることができます。そのアーキテクチャは、ダウンタイムなしの頻繁なアップグレードに最適化されており、これは以前のメインネットのイテレーションやテストネットで検証されています。Aptosブロックチェーンは、埋め込み型のオンチェーン変更管理プロトコルを含み、新しい技術革新を迅速に展開し、新しいWeb3アプリケーションのシナリオをサポートします。## 7. 提案に基づく報酬メカニズムAptosは提案パフォーマンスに基づくステーキング報酬システムを実装し、より大きな分散化を促進しています。投票ベースのシステムと比較して、このメカニズムは地域間の遅延に対してあまり敏感ではなく、遠隔地のノードの報酬率を向上させ、地理的分布の影響を抑制します。報酬モデルは投票行動を同時に考慮しています。良好な投票パフォーマンスは提案者の選挙確率に影響を与えます。## 8. 高性能スパースマークルツリーAptosはJellyfish Merkle Tree (JMT)を使用して設計され、単調増加のバージョンベースのキー方式を利用して基盤ストレージエンジンを最適化しています。JMTはCPU、I/O、ストレージの占有の間で実用的なバランスを達成しました。JMTを除いて、Aptosはキャッシュと並列処理のために特別に設計されたメモリ内のロックフリーのスパースMerkleツリーを実現しており、高性能なグローバルステート更新を実現するためにBlock-STMと組み合わせて使用されています。! [Aptosを新しいパブリックチェーンリーダーにするための8つのイノベーション](https://img-cdn.gateio.im/social/moments-bcbc2b1a646b35c43945b9a2968d811f)
Aptosネットワーク8つの革新推進力:開発の強化、パフォーマンスの向上、分散化の促進
Aptosネットワークの8つの革新推進力
Aptosは、遅延が非常に低く、スループットが非常に高いブロックチェーンプラットフォームとして、開発者がweb3アプリケーションを構築するための大きな利便性を提供します。この記事では、Aptosネットワークの繁栄を促進する8つのコアイノベーションについて紹介します。
! Aptosを新しいパブリックチェーンのリーダーにするための8つのイノベーション
1. Move言語はアプリケーション開発を最適化します
AptosはMoveプログラミング言語を統合しており、開発者にとってより良い開発環境と効率を提供しています。Moveは表現力が高く、使いやすい言語であり、安全な資産管理のために設計されています。
Aptosは、言語とフレームワークのレベルで多くの機能を追加することによって、Moveエコシステムを大幅に改善しました。これには、完全なセキュリティアーキテクチャ、設定可能なガス計測、コードのアップグレード可能性などが含まれます。Moveバリデーターはスマートコントラクトに追加のセキュリティ保証を提供し、Aptos上で積極的に拡張されています。
多くのMove言語の初期研究者や開発者は、Aptosエコシステムで活躍し続け、Move言語とコミュニティを強化しています。4年間のテストと検証を経て、Moveは生産環境で使用できる成熟した開発言語となりました。
2. Block-STMはより多くのプログラミングの自由度を提供します
Block-STMは、新しいタイプのスマートコントラクト並行実行エンジンであり、Aptosのトランザクションメモリと楽観的並行制御原則に基づいて構築されています。この新しいトランザクション並行化手法は、開発体験に影響を与えることなく、トランザクション処理速度を向上させることができます。
他の取引のアトミシティを破壊する必要がある並行実行エンジンとは異なり、Block-STMは開発者が制約なくコーディングできるようにし、実際のアプリケーションで高いスループットと低いレイテンシを実現します。開発者は、より豊富なアトミシティ操作をサポートする高度に並行化されたアプリケーションを簡単に構築でき、ユーザーエクスペリエンスを向上させます。
3. オンチェーンガバナンスが分散化を促進する
Aptosは、ネットワークと仮想マシンの設定をシームレスに変更できるオンチェーンガバナンスメカニズムを備えており、真の分散型で無許可のlayer1をサポートしています。Aptosコミュニティは、epochの持続時間の変更、バリデーターの権益要件、コアコードのアップグレードなど、ブロックチェーンの動作に影響を与える提案を作成し、投票することができました。
4. AptosBFTv4によるコンセンサス効率の向上
AptosBFTv4は、厳格な正当性証明を持つ最初の商用ブロックチェーンBFTプロトコルです。これはHotstuffを基に改良され、提出の遅延を3ステップから2ステップに減少させ、通信コストを犠牲にすることなく33%の遅延を削減しました。
AptosBFTv4の実装は、安全性とアップグレード可能性を考慮し、不変量を明確に分離して隔離と監査を容易にしています。同一のソフトウェアは4回のアップグレードを経て実際のネットワークでテストされ、その開発プロセスの周到さと堅牢性が証明されました。
5. ユーザーの信頼を高めるためのセキュリティ対策
Aptosアカウントは、キーのローテーション、暗号化の機敏性、ハイブリッドホスティングモデルなど、柔軟なキー管理をサポートしています。アカウントとキーのデカップリングにより、Aptosは新しいデジタル署名アルゴリズムをシームレスに追加できるようになります。
ウォレットは取引の事前実行機能を使用でき、ユーザーが署名する前に取引結果を説明し、フィッシングなどのセキュリティリスクを軽減します。Aptosは、シリアル番号、期限、チェーンIDの三重保護を通じて、署名の無限の有効性を防ぎます。
Aptosのコンセンサスプロトコルと認証されたストレージは、軽量クライアントへのシームレスなサポートを実現し、より安全で信頼性の高いユーザー体験を提供します。誰でもフルノードに接続して、認証されたデータに直接アクセスできます。
6. 未来に向けたモジュール式アーキテクチャ
Aptosはモジュール化された柔軟な設計理念を採用しており、頻繁なアップグレードをサポートし、最新の技術革新を迅速に取り入れることができます。そのアーキテクチャは、ダウンタイムなしの頻繁なアップグレードに最適化されており、これは以前のメインネットのイテレーションやテストネットで検証されています。
Aptosブロックチェーンは、埋め込み型のオンチェーン変更管理プロトコルを含み、新しい技術革新を迅速に展開し、新しいWeb3アプリケーションのシナリオをサポートします。
7. 提案に基づく報酬メカニズム
Aptosは提案パフォーマンスに基づくステーキング報酬システムを実装し、より大きな分散化を促進しています。投票ベースのシステムと比較して、このメカニズムは地域間の遅延に対してあまり敏感ではなく、遠隔地のノードの報酬率を向上させ、地理的分布の影響を抑制します。
報酬モデルは投票行動を同時に考慮しています。良好な投票パフォーマンスは提案者の選挙確率に影響を与えます。
8. 高性能スパースマークルツリー
AptosはJellyfish Merkle Tree (JMT)を使用して設計され、単調増加のバージョンベースのキー方式を利用して基盤ストレージエンジンを最適化しています。JMTはCPU、I/O、ストレージの占有の間で実用的なバランスを達成しました。
JMTを除いて、Aptosはキャッシュと並列処理のために特別に設計されたメモリ内のロックフリーのスパースMerkleツリーを実現しており、高性能なグローバルステート更新を実現するためにBlock-STMと組み合わせて使用されています。
! Aptosを新しいパブリックチェーンリーダーにするための8つのイノベーション